Phone number ☎️ 03300530941 👆 is reported as a contact number used by Volkswagen Group and AA for roadside assistance queries, particularly related to alleged direct debit payment issues. Some users confirm the number is genuine and linked to official roadside assistance services for Volkswagen, Audi, and Skoda, with explanations given about system faults affecting online renewals. However, there is considerable suspicion over letters prompting calls to this number, as many have experienced conflicting information or suspect scams. Users advise verifying any communication by cross-checking with official documentation and banking records and using alternative, known contact numbers to confirm account status. Caution and due diligence are recommended before responding to requests linked to this number.

About 03 Numbers
Several organizations adopt 03 numbers instead of the more expensive 08 numbers. For example, a number of public sector entities have shifted from 0845 numbers to 0345. The cost of calls matches calls to geographic numbers (01 or 02). The cost of calls are influenced by the time of the day, and most providers offer call packages that permit calls free of charge at specific times of the day. The cost of calls from mobiles differ depending on the chosen calling plan. Usually, these calls are incorporated in free call packages.
